Transaction 763683f11bc616c32769cdc21940e180fcd3f9a730db57e45ff3c16bf0465975
1 Input
2 Outputs
- 763683f11bc616c32769cdc21940e180fcd3f9a730db57e45ff3c16bf0465975:0
- 763683f11bc616c32769cdc21940e180fcd3f9a730db57e45ff3c16bf0465975:1
value 77800
address 1H5NhWrevzzGVxoiB6tb4vxf5M8X2vyqPS
value 12648
address 1Ho6wEt7SDx6Xd4f5oXFyMTETQTCzDEUJT